Planning for Progression
Area of Learning and Experience Science and Technology
Statement of What Matters Being curious and searching for answers is essential to understanding and predicting phenomena
Key Concept Being Curious- Questioning and Investigating
Overarching Learning Intention To use logic, evidence and creativity to inquire into and apply scientific knowledge and evaluate scientific claims to help make informed decisions so that learners enjoy solving problems and can explain their ideas and concepts.
Concepts to consider within this Statement of What Matters Question, Observe, Test, Evaluate and Justify

Learning Intentions
Skills- what will I be able to do by the end of the learning experience? To make simple predictions



To Choose simple equipment



To use non-standard measurements e.g. 5 cups



To draw simple diagrams

To come to basic conclusions
To practice and begin to use scientific vocabulary



To begin to use and understand standard measurements e.g. kg, s, m.
To enhance scientific vocabulary



To practice using previous knowledge and understanding when predicting



To use standard measurements e.g. kg, s, m.



To develop their conclusions
To predict using previous knowledge and understanding



To change ideas that’s suggested, and own ideas, to an investigation



To use standard measurements e.g. kg, s, N, m.
To decide on the most appropriate investigation



To make predictions using

knowledge, understanding and previous preliminary work



To search for information in a systematic way, processed and analysed for specific purposes

Enhance use of standard measurements e.g. kg, s, N, m, J, w.
Knowledge- What will I know and understand by the end of the learning experience? Show curiosity and question how things work.



Explore the environment, make observations and communicate my ideas.
Ask questions and use my experience to suggest simple methods of inquiry.



Recognise patterns from my observations and investigations and can communicate my findings.
Ask questions and use my experience to suggest methods of inquiry.



Suggest conclusions as a result of carrying out my inquiries.



Evaluate methods to suggest improvements.
Identify questions that can be investigated scientifically and suggest suitable methods of inquiry.

Suggest conclusions as a result of carrying out my inquiries.



Evaluate methods to suggest improvements.
Research, devise and use suitable methods of inquiry to investigate my scientific questions.



select relevant scientific knowledge from a range of evidence sources to evaluate claims presented as scientific facts.
